This subdirectory contains Adaptec's AHA-1540/1542/1640 (AHA-1740/1744 in
standard mode) NetWare 386 v3.0 SCSI disk module and ASPI manager.  The
revision of this driver is v1.0.  This driver has been FULLY Novell certified
under NetWare v3.0.

To load the driver, you would type the following at the NetWare 386 console
screen:

:load [path] asw1440 [options]

Please consult the user's manual for a description of the available command
line options.

NOTE:  Although this driver also runs under NetWare 386 v3.1, we recommend
       you use Adaptec's NetWare 386 v3.1 specific driver (\NET386.31)
       included on this disk.  It will give you more functionality.
       - Driver will only support up to 16M of ram.
